Vico Persson transforms recycled materials such as food packages and discarded objects into collages and sculptures. Freshly returned to Antwerp after a residency at the Villa Empain in Brussels, he is now working on new collages and assemblage sculptural at T-Space in Antwerp.
Vico works across several media including drawing, ceramics, assemblage art and collage art. The collage series "Forms of Residue" is an ongoing production of works, started in 2022, in which he transforms leftover materials - such as food packaging and the last bit of residue paint - into abstract creations. Other work series include “Double Truth” and “Twin Flowers” where the artist combines real photos or vintage illustrations with AI created counterparts. By combining “real” images with AI-generated versions of the same subjects, thereby challenging our understanding of authenticity in an increasingly digital world.
